TenTonHammer has announced their Games Convention Leipzig 2007 Awards and Tabula Rasa was named both Best Sci-Fi MMOG and Most Innovative. Here are the details...
Best Sci-Fi MMOG - Tabula Rasa
Tabula Rasa, simply put, is post-apolcalyptic done right. Cloning, PvP, and the Logos system aren't just innovative gameplay mechanics, it turns out they're storyline appropriate. Not to mention that the just announced tier 4 "Spy" class and its polymorph ability looks like a blast.
Most Innovative - Tabula Rasa
We can't get enough of Tabula Rasa. Creating savepoints for MMOGs was a stroke of absolute genius, and Logos is as clever as it seems plausible for character development. Now that we've finally seen how different and interesting the top tier classes are, the verdict is clear. In a genre dominated by orcs and elves, Tabula Rasa is fun with guns and near-future technology on a grand scale.
